Searched refs:section_nr (Results 1 – 7 of 7) sorted by relevance
/Linux-v4.19/mm/ |
D | sparse.c | 51 static void set_section_nid(unsigned long section_nr, int nid) in set_section_nid() argument 53 section_to_node_table[section_nr] = nid; in set_section_nid() 56 static inline void set_section_nid(unsigned long section_nr, int nid) in set_section_nid() argument 76 static int __meminit sparse_index_init(unsigned long section_nr, int nid) in sparse_index_init() argument 78 unsigned long root = SECTION_NR_TO_ROOT(section_nr); in sparse_index_init() 93 static inline int sparse_index_init(unsigned long section_nr, int nid) in sparse_index_init() argument 179 int section_nr = __section_nr(ms); in section_mark_present() local 181 if (section_nr > __highest_present_section_nr) in section_mark_present() 182 __highest_present_section_nr = section_nr; in section_mark_present() 187 static inline int next_present_section_nr(int section_nr) in next_present_section_nr() argument [all …]
|
D | memory_hotplug.c | 165 unsigned long *usemap, mapsize, section_nr, i; in register_page_bootmem_info_section() local 169 section_nr = pfn_to_section_nr(start_pfn); in register_page_bootmem_info_section() 170 ms = __nr_to_section(section_nr); in register_page_bootmem_info_section() 173 memmap = sparse_decode_mem_map(ms->section_mem_map, section_nr); in register_page_bootmem_info_section() 185 get_page_bootmem(section_nr, page, SECTION_INFO); in register_page_bootmem_info_section() 193 get_page_bootmem(section_nr, page, MIX_SECTION_INFO); in register_page_bootmem_info_section() 199 unsigned long *usemap, mapsize, section_nr, i; in register_page_bootmem_info_section() local 203 section_nr = pfn_to_section_nr(start_pfn); in register_page_bootmem_info_section() 204 ms = __nr_to_section(section_nr); in register_page_bootmem_info_section() 206 memmap = sparse_decode_mem_map(ms->section_mem_map, section_nr); in register_page_bootmem_info_section() [all …]
|
/Linux-v4.19/drivers/base/ |
D | memory.c | 37 static inline int base_memory_block_id(int section_nr) in base_memory_block_id() argument 39 return section_nr / sections_per_block; in base_memory_block_id() 196 unsigned long section_nr = pfn_to_section_nr(start_pfn); in pages_correctly_probed() local 197 unsigned long section_nr_end = section_nr + sections_per_block; in pages_correctly_probed() 205 for (; section_nr < section_nr_end; section_nr++) { in pages_correctly_probed() 209 if (!present_section_nr(section_nr)) { in pages_correctly_probed() 211 section_nr, pfn, pfn + PAGES_PER_SECTION); in pages_correctly_probed() 213 } else if (!valid_section_nr(section_nr)) { in pages_correctly_probed() 215 section_nr, pfn, pfn + PAGES_PER_SECTION); in pages_correctly_probed() 217 } else if (online_section_nr(section_nr)) { in pages_correctly_probed() [all …]
|
/Linux-v4.19/arch/x86/mm/ |
D | init_64.c | 1484 void register_page_bootmem_memmap(unsigned long section_nr, in register_page_bootmem_memmap() argument 1505 get_page_bootmem(section_nr, pgd_page(*pgd), MIX_SECTION_INFO); in register_page_bootmem_memmap() 1512 get_page_bootmem(section_nr, p4d_page(*p4d), MIX_SECTION_INFO); in register_page_bootmem_memmap() 1519 get_page_bootmem(section_nr, pud_page(*pud), MIX_SECTION_INFO); in register_page_bootmem_memmap() 1526 get_page_bootmem(section_nr, pmd_page(*pmd), in register_page_bootmem_memmap() 1532 get_page_bootmem(section_nr, pte_page(*pte), in register_page_bootmem_memmap() 1544 get_page_bootmem(section_nr, page++, in register_page_bootmem_memmap()
|
/Linux-v4.19/arch/powerpc/platforms/pseries/ |
D | hotplug-memory.c | 247 unsigned long section_nr; in lmb_to_memblock() local 251 section_nr = pfn_to_section_nr(PFN_DOWN(lmb->base_addr)); in lmb_to_memblock() 252 mem_sect = __nr_to_section(section_nr); in lmb_to_memblock()
|
/Linux-v4.19/arch/powerpc/mm/ |
D | init_64.c | 306 void register_page_bootmem_memmap(unsigned long section_nr, in register_page_bootmem_memmap() argument
|
/Linux-v4.19/include/linux/ |
D | mm.h | 2688 void register_page_bootmem_memmap(unsigned long section_nr, struct page *map,
|